2. AZDOME Mobile App Setup & Connection

For Wi-Fi-enabled AZDOME dash cams, you can manage settings, live-stream video, and access digital guides via the mobile application:

  1. Download the AZDOME App or CarKeeeper / CarAssist App from the Google Play Store or Apple App Store.

  2. Go to your phone's Wi-Fi settings and connect to the dash cam's built-in Wi-Fi network (default SSID and password can be found in your physical manual or on-screen).

  3. Open the app to view real-time footage and manage device settings. (Note: If live view fails to load, temporarily disable cellular data for the app in your phone settings).

3. Key Operating Specifications

Operation Requirement & Recommended Setting
MicroSD Card Format Use a high-speed Class 10, UHS-I, or U3 MicroSD card (up to 128GB/256GB). Always format a new card directly inside the dash cam's settings menu before first use.
Power Supply AZDOME cameras utilize a built-in supercapacitor (designed only to save system time) and must remain connected to continuous power via the provided 12V car charger while driving.
24H Parking Surveillance To use 24-hour parking monitoring, collision detection, or time-lapse recording, you must install an official AZDOME 3-wire hardwire kit directly to your vehicle's fuse panel.
